[ Vocabulary and Grammar ]
Mai often ___________ her homework after dinner.
A. to do
B. doing
C. do
D. does

Random Topics:
Grammar Error Correction (Simple Present Tense)Habitual and Continuous TensesModals VerbVerb to beZero Conditional SentenceVocabulary & GrammarComparative & Superlative AdverbsAdverb of MannerTypes of Sentence StructuresSubject/Verb Agreement with Collective NounsOther quiz:
Grammar › ViewIt is raining here _____________ it is not raining there.
A. and
B. but
C. or
Quantifiers › View
Do you ____ time reading in English and listening to podcasts?
A. pass much
B. pass a lot of
C. spend many
D. spend much
Future Tenses › ViewPlease, buy some eggs. I …………………. a cake.
A. will bake
B. am baking
C. am going to bake
D. will be baking
Reported Speech › View
well
A. DO
B. MAKE
